## Account Recovery — Larkspool Metrics Sidecar

Scope: service account for the metrics-aggregation sidecar on the Fenridge cluster.

If the sidecar's account is disabled or its token expires silently, aggregation halts and dashboards flatline within minutes. Do not recreate the account; recover it. Steps: open the Larkspool admin CLI, run the recovery flow, select the sidecar principal, and confirm. The flow prompts once for the recovery passphrase, which is recorded below.

recovery phrase for fawif-tajeg: norael-aldmir-casir-brivan-ulaion

## Configuration

The Ledgerpane audit-log viewer reads its settings from `.env` at startup. `LP_RETENTION_DAYS` controls how far back the viewer queries (default 90), and `LP_PAGE_SIZE` caps rows per fetch. Note for the sync: the viewer is read-only by design; all writes go through the ingest service. The one sensitive value is the read-replica credential the viewer uses to connect, which belongs on the line directly below.

sealed setting: VAULT_KEY20=69e2a0b23f1a79fbf692

Subject: Goods lift reserved Thursday — please plan around it

Hello team assistants,

On Thursday the goods lift at Pellamore House is reserved all day for the Wrenfield Catering delivery, so please route any bulky items through the west stairwell instead. If you must access the lift lobby for an urgent delivery, it now requires the door code noted below.

turnstile pass: bdg-TXR-4

## Authentication

Before Slimcrate will strip layers from your plugin's base image, it has to talk to our internal registry to resolve manifests. Don't worry, it's read-only access. Point your config at the `registry.internal` endpoint and you're basically done. The one thing you do need is a valid key, which we've included just below.

gateway credential: kto23_LX9A4ys6i4nzHtpOLNLodKK

Ticket TL-register: the `tailfin` CLI needs a new release cut to fix the flag that drops the last log line on rotation. Patch is merged; staging verified. On-call should not roll this out without sign-off. Approval for the production release must come from the owner named below.

named custodian: Brivan Eliath Quenox Frador